 All-on-4 Implants: A Permanent and Revolutionary Solution


The All-on-4 implant system is a modern dental technique that provides a permanent solution for full arch tooth replacement. This method uses only four implants to secure an entire row of teeth, making it an efficient and durable option for those who have lost most or all of their teeth. Patients in Mexico have increasingly turned to All-on-4 implants due to their reliability and the natural appearance they offer.


 Key Benefits of All-on-4 Implants in Mexico:

- Long-Lasting Results: Once All-on-4 implants are placed, they can last for decades, provided that the patient follows good oral hygiene practices. Unlike traditional dentures, which need regular adjustments, All-on-4 implants remain stable and secure over the long term.

- Natural Appearance and Comfort: The All-on-4 system offers a highly realistic appearance. The implants fuse with the jawbone, providing a fixed foundation for the prosthetic teeth, which ensures that they look and feel like natural teeth.

- Fast Treatment Time: In many cases, patients can have their All-on-4 implants placed and leave the clinic with a new set of teeth on the same day. This “teeth-in-a-day” approach is one of the major advantages that attracts patients.

- Minimized Need for Bone Grafting: Due to the strategic placement of the implants, All-on-4 often eliminates the need for bone grafts, even for patients with some degree of bone loss.


 Traditional Dentures: A Reliable Non-Surgical Option


For patients seeking a cost-effective, non-invasive method to replace missing teeth, traditional dentures remain a solid choice. Dentures are custom-made removable prosthetics that replace either a full or partial set of teeth. Though not as permanent or comfortable as implants, they continue to be a popular solution due to their affordability and ease of use.


 Benefits of Traditional Dentures in Mexico:

- Affordable Upfront Costs: Traditional dentures are generally more affordable than implants, making them an attractive option for patients seeking immediate tooth replacement without a large financial investment.

- Non-Surgical Solution: Dentures do not require surgery, making them ideal for patients who may not be candidates for implants due to medical reasons or who prefer a non-invasive approach.

- Quick Turnaround: Patients can typically receive their dentures within a few weeks after an initial consultation, meaning they don’t have to wait long to restore their smile.


 A Side-by-Side Comparison: All-on-4 Implants vs. Traditional Dentures


While both All-on-4 implants and traditional dentures serve to restore dental function and aesthetics, their fundamental differences make them suitable for different patients. Here's how they compare:


- Permanence: All-on-4 implants offer a permanent solution that lasts for decades, whereas traditional dentures often need replacement every 5-10 years.

- Stability: Implants are firmly anchored in the jawbone, offering a secure, immovable set of teeth. In contrast, dentures can shift or become loose, particularly when eating harder foods.

- Comfort: Implants feel much more like natural teeth, while dentures, despite being custom-fitted, may cause discomfort over time, especially if they no longer fit snugly due to changes in the jaw shape.

- Maintenance: All-on-4 implants require minimal maintenance beyond normal brushing and flossing, while dentures need to be removed for cleaning and may require adhesives to stay in place.

 Understanding the Costs of All-on-4 Implants and Traditional Dentures in Mexico


One of the main reasons patients consider Mexico for their dental treatments is the substantial savings. However, the costs of these treatments can vary based on factors such as the clinic, the complexity of the procedure, and the materials used.


- All-on-4 Implants: In Mexico, the cost of All-on-4 implants generally ranges from $10,000 to $25,000 USD per arch, depending on the clinic and the complexity of the case. This is significantly lower than in many Western countries, where the same procedure could cost between $20,000 and $50,000 USD.

 

- Traditional Dentures: Dentures, being more affordable upfront, typically cost between $500 and $2,000 USD for a complete set in Mexico. However, patients should keep in mind the potential for additional costs over time, such as replacements and adjustments.


 Longevity and Success Rates: Making the Right Investment


Another key factor in deciding between All-on-4 implants and traditional dentures is their long-term success. All-on-4 implants are known for their high success rate, often exceeding 95% in most cases. The implants bond with the jawbone, creating a stable and lasting foundation for prosthetic teeth, which significantly reduces the need for future dental interventions.


In contrast, traditional dentures may wear out or become uncomfortable over time as the shape of the mouth changes. While they are effective for immediate tooth replacement, their long-term comfort and stability are not comparable to that of implants.


 All-on-4 vs. Dentures: Which is Best for You?


The decision between All-on-4 implants and traditional dentures comes down to your personal priorities. All-on-4 implants are ideal for patients seeking a long-lasting, permanent solution that closely mimics the look and feel of natural teeth. They are a higher upfront investment, but the long-term benefits—such as comfort, stability, and lower maintenance—often make them the preferred choice for those who value a permanent fix.


On the other hand, traditional dentures offer an affordable, non-invasive solution. They are particularly suited for patients who are either not candidates for surgery or who need a quicker, more budget-friendly option. However, dentures require more upkeep and replacement over time, which should be considered when evaluating the overall costs.
